A Postgraduate Certificate in Mindfulness-Based Insomnia Treatment provides specialized training in evidence-based interventions for sleep disorders. The program equips participants with the skills to effectively treat insomnia using mindfulness techniques, improving patient outcomes and overall well-being.
Learning outcomes typically include mastering the core principles of mindfulness, understanding the cognitive and behavioral aspects of insomnia, and gaining proficiency in delivering Mindfulness-Based Insomnia Treatment (MBIT) programs. Graduates will be competent in assessing clients, tailoring interventions, and tracking progress. The curriculum often incorporates practical application through supervised case studies and role-playing.
The duration of a Postgraduate Certificate in Mindfulness-Based Insomnia Treatment varies depending on the institution, generally ranging from a few months to a year of part-time study. This flexible structure caters to working professionals seeking to enhance their clinical expertise.

Specific modules may include cognitive behavioral therapy for insomnia (CBT-I) principles, sleep hygiene education, acceptance and commitment therapy (ACT) integration, and relapse prevention strategies. These components build a comprehensive understanding of holistic insomnia management.
